REGENERATION organisations West Lakes Renaissance and Cumbria Vision have welcomed the announcement that Nuclear Management Partners Ltd (NMP) will become the new owners of Sellafield, as an important step in establishing West Cumbria as Britain’s Energy CoastTM.
The Nuclear Decommissioning Authority has entered into a “Transitional Agreement” which will see shares in Sellafield Ltd transferred from British Nuclear Fuels Limited to NMP – which comprises of Washington International Holdings Ltd., AMEC and AREVA NC. The transfer is scheduled for November 24 and will see NMP officially become the Parent Body Organisation for Sellafield, charged with decommissioning the site of the world’s first nuclear power station.
